IMAGECrew Chief John "Pappy" C. Ford and Assistant Crew Chief Richard "Slug" Schultheis of the 385th Bomb Group with their B-17 Flying Fortress (serial number 42-5897) nicknamed "Roundtrip Jack". Handwritten caption on reverse: '14/8/43.' Handwritten caption also on reverse: '"Roundtrip Jack". S/N/ 42-5897. -VE. Carried and fired first 20mm canon[sic] mounted in nose. Tests conducted by W/O Nugent [Thompson]. L to R: Crew Chief "Pappy" - John C. Ford; Asst. Crew Chief: "Slug" Richard Schultheis. When Ford became Flt. Chief, Schultheis trained at "The Wash" and became gunner. Flew 35M [missions].'
